- [ ] Verify offline audio packs for the Harlowe Museum guide app load correctly in airplane mode on both supported tablet models. New folks: this catches a cache bug we've hit twice, so don't skip it. Log the result in the release sheet alongside the candidate's build token, which is stamped below.

pipeline stamp: htk9_ce63042d9

Sampling is deterministic per trace ID: if a trace is kept, every line within it is kept, so your plugin's entries will never be orphaned from their surrounding context. Error-level lines bypass sampling entirely. Plugins cannot override sample rates, but you should know the defaults when estimating how often your debug output will actually land in storage. The effective constants are listed below.

tuning table, hafog-bahaf:
QUOTAS = {
    "praion": 144,
    "briax": 906,
    "silwyn": 451,
}

## Step 4: Repoint the alert fan-out

Okay, this is the fiddly bit. StormRelay's fan-out worker now pushes weather alerts through the new Gustline broker instead of the old queue on Cloudmere. If you're on call when this lands, watch the dead-letter count for the first hour — spikes usually mean a stale topic mapping. Don't restart the worker mid-burst; drain it first with the pause flag. Once drained, apply the values below to each fan-out node before resuming.

service settings:
[casax]
port = 6379
team = rusir
host = casax.zemvarhq.corp
region = outer-4
access_code = ac_9808ce
timeout_ms = 1500

The Pellmont TileForge cache layer refuses writes because its signing vault auto-locked after three failed plugin handshakes. External plugin authors: your render hooks will return stale tiles until this clears. We've rotated the handshake tokens and confirmed the vault contents are intact. To resume publishing, unlock the vault from the Stonewick admin console, re-register your plugin manifest, and flush the regional tile buckets. The console will prompt for the recovery passphrase, which is provided below.

unlock words, kawig-bawef: belax-sorir-druax-ulaiel-wenael-belael